Summary:
The Senate of the Métis Nation suspended Penton's membership in the Métis Nation. Penton applied for judicial review.
The Alberta Court of Queen's Bench allowed the application.
Administrative Law - Topic 526
The hearing and decision - Conduct of hearing - Adjournments - Penton was called before the Métis Senate to substantiate his right to hold membership in the Métis Nation - He asked for an adjournment so he could obtain some documents in the Senate's possession - The Senate granted the adjournment - The Senate sat the next two days in Penton's absence and determined the matter on its merits - The Alberta Court of Queen's Bench held that once the Senate granted the adjournment it was required to provide Penton with reasonable notice of the date the hearing was adjourned to and the failure to do so was a breach of natural justice - See paragraphs 37 to 43.
Administrative Law - Topic 2088
Natural justice - Constitution of board or tribunal - Bias - Apprehension of - Penton was called before the Métis Senate to substantiate his right to hold membership in the Métis Nation - Four members of the Senate admitted bias and declined to hear the merits of the matter - Penton claimed that other members were biased - The four members who had admitted bias continued to sit to determine the composition of the Senate and whether other members were biased - The Alberta Court of Queen's Bench held that there was a clear statement of an apprehension of bias and judicial review was available regardless of the nature of the function being exercised by the board - See paragraphs 32 to 36.
Administrative Law - Topic 2442
Natural justice - Procedure - Notice - When required - [See Administrative Law - Topic 526 ].
Indians, Inuit and Métis - Topic 2107
Nations, tribes and bands - Bands - Membership - The Senate of the Métis Nation suspended Penton's membership in the Nation claiming that he lacked the necessary heritage - He had been a member for six years - Penton claimed that the Senate lacked jurisdiction to determine his membership because it was limited to determining applications for membership or suspending members for "grave conduct" - Penton claimed that lack of the necessary heritage was not grave conduct - The Alberta Court of Queen's Bench refused to interfere with the Senate's decision where it was not patently unreasonable - See paragraphs 18 to 23.
Indians, Inuit and Métis - Topic 6240.4
Government of Indians - Métis Nation - Bylaws - The Senate of the Métis Nation suspended Penton's membership in the Nation - Penton claimed that the Senate lost its jurisdiction because it did not act in accordance with the Charter of Rights, Freedoms and Responsibilities of the Métis Nation and the "Laws of St. Laurent" - The Alberta Court of Queen's Bench stated that although the Senate could set fairness standards for itself, "where those standards restrict or prevent the Senate from the exercise of a capacity granted it by the [Nation's] bylaws then the standards move beyond the realm of administrative fairness in the sense of procedural matters and into the substantive aspects of the decision itself" - The court held that the Senate did not lose jurisdiction - See paragraphs 26 to 31.
